Transponder Chip Issues
Chipped keys (also known as transponder keys) have been used for some time and are a great technology to prevent theft. They prevent thieves from hot-wiring a vehicle and thereby starting it. This is accomplished through an embedded microchip in the key, which sends signals to the car when it's inserted into the ignition.
These signals are radio waves which activate the chip. When activated, the chip will respond with a code that is recognized by your vehicle. Essentially, it's like sending your driver's license to the clerk at your bank. Once your key is inserted, it will unlock the doors and start the engine.
So, if you lose your chipped key, you'll need to have it replaced with a brand new one from a dealer. It will cost more since it's more advanced. However, it's worth the extra expense because you're protecting your vehicle from people trying to take it away.
It is important to understand that not all locksmiths or hardware stores will provide this service. You will likely need go to a local toyota key replacement dealership to get this service performed. They will have the best chance of recognizing your car key. They can also program your key into your car.
It involves connecting the key with an appropriate programmers that will extract the required details for the car's computers to recognize it. It will then match your key's code with a transponder, and then program it into your car's computer system. This will stop your car from being started with any other key.
Even with this amazing technology, your keys with chip may not work at all times. It could happen that the key will not turn on the engine or unlock your doors. This indicates that the transponder chip likely to be damaged.
To fix this issue, you'll need to visit your local Toyota dealer and have the chip reprogrammed into your vehicle. You will need to bring your photo ID as well as the VIN number of your vehicle to the dealership to complete the process.
Key Fob Battery Issues
A key fob may need an additional battery when it stops functioning. A dead or dying car key fob battery is a nightmare but it's usually something that can be repaired easily. There are a variety of factors that could cause this problem but, in the majority of cases it comes down to simply needing the replacement of a battery.
The first step is to open the case. It should be simple to open the case. Just insert an instrument that is flat such as screwdriver, into the small slot where the key is. This will allow access to the circuit board in green, and then you can take out the battery. Make sure to note what kind of battery you require (which is typically written on the original or can be located by looking in your owner's manual) Then, you can purchase a replacement and replace it. Verify that the new battery is properly placed in the case and on the circuit board. Then, test it to ensure it is functioning properly.
Another factor that can cause a key fob's battery to die quickly is excessive use. The fob you use frequently will drain the battery faster than the case if you only used it occasionally, and this can be difficult to avoid. Other factors that could lead to a quick battery death include extreme temperatures, moisture, and electrical interference from other electronic devices. To prolong the lifespan of your key fob, keep it from these items.
